Disney is hitting their stride with live action remakes of their animated classics; their latest film, Beauty and the Beast, is on track to follow in the footsteps of The Jungle Book as a box office hit. However, many have questioned why Disney is bothering to remake the movie at all, considering the original was an Oscar-winning classic. 

In a new featurette, director Bill Condon, (along with Emma Watson, Dan Stevens, and other cast members) address this concern, along with showing some behind-the-scenes footage and new shots from the film. Check it out below, and let us know your thoughts in the comments!

Beauty and the Beast invites you to theaters on March 17, 2017.


 
Disney’s “Beauty and the Beast” is a live-action re-telling of the studio’s animated classic which refashions the classic characters from the tale as old as time for a contemporary audience, staying true to the original music while updating the score with several new songs. “Beauty and the Beast” is the fantastic journey of Belle, a bright, beautiful and independent young woman who is taken prisoner by a beast in his castle. Despite her fears, she befriends the castle’s enchanted staff and learns to look beyond the Beast’s hideous exterior and realize the kind heart and soul of the true Prince within.
